Tasting note Menetou Salon

 

Bright red wine with a spicy fruity aroma of fresh cherries, herbs and slightly caramel. The taste starts spicy and develops a mild tannin; jam-like fragrant in the aftertaste.
 
Description

Menetou-salon is now known to many wine lovers as one of the top sauvignons of the Loire. Much less known is the planting of the Pinot Noir grape. In the neighboring area of Sancerre, Pinot Noir is often grown on less well-located plots, which results in a somewhat thin, sharp red wine. This is not the case with Clément in Menetou. He selected the warmest vineyards, allowing this red grape to develop beautiful ripeness. In addition, the vines, which are between thirty and fifty years old, produce concentrated grapes.
 
The second fermentation and maturation takes place in small oak barrels. The wine remains in partly new oak barrels for approximately twelve months, so only a slight wood influence can be tasted. In the words of Pierre Clément 'un très grand pinot noir'.
 
Specifications
Grape variety: Pinot Noir
Land: France
Wine region: Loire
Bottle Closure: Cork
Alcohol: 13,5 %
